Lee 'Faker' Sang-hyeok, widely regarded as the greatest League of Legends player of all time, has extended his contract with T1 until 2029. This extension ensures that the 'Unkillable Demon King' will continue to compete at the highest level for years to come, much to the delight of T1 fans worldwide.

Key Insights

Faker, now 29, will play for T1 until he is at least 33, a rare feat in the demanding world of professional League of Legends. This is notable because most pro gamers retire around 25 when reflexes decline.

He achieved his 3,500th kill in the LCK, further cementing his legacy.

Faker is exempt from mandatory military service due to his gold medal win at the 2022 Asian Games.

T1 reached the finals of the Mid-Season Invitational 2025 and secured a 3rd place finish at the Esports World Cup 2025, demonstrating their continued competitiveness.

In-Depth Analysis

Faker's extension with T1 marks a significant moment in esports history. Having debuted with SK Telecom T1 (now T1) in 2013, Faker has remained loyal to the organization, amassing five World Championship titles and numerous other accolades. His consistent performance and dedication have earned him the nicknames 'the Lionel Messi of esports' and 'the unkillable demon king.' T1 beat other top teams such as Gen.G and DRX this season.

Faker's influence extends beyond his in-game skills. He is a role model for aspiring esports athletes and has met with prominent figures like Tottenham Hotspur captain Son Heung-min. Riot Games recognized his contributions by inducting him into the League of Legends Hall of Legends.

The contract extension also signifies T1's commitment to maintaining a competitive roster. While other players' contracts vary, Faker's long-term commitment provides stability and leadership for the team as they aim for further success in the LCK and international tournaments. The team narrowly lost to Gen.G at the Mid-Season Invitational final 3-2 in Vancouver.
